About This Book
What if a walrus decided to run away from the zoo and explore the big city all by himself? Imagine spotting him disguised as a firefighter, a businessman, or even a high-stepping dancer! Can you find Walrus before the zookeeper does?

Quick Assessment
This wordless picture book follows a clever walrus who escapes the zoo and blends into various city scenes using creative disguises. Perfect for early readers ages 5-8, it encourages observation skills and imagination without any text, making it accessible and engaging for young children. There is no intense content, making it a safe and fun choice for early literacy development.
